🚇 🗺️ Getting There
The Radha Vallabh Temple is located in the heart of Vrindavan. You can reach it by auto-rickshaw or cycle-rickshaw from anywhere in the city. Many pilgrims also walk to the temple if staying nearby. If arriving by bus or train, you'll likely need a taxi or auto-rickshaw to reach the temple area.
Parking can be challenging in the narrow lanes of Vrindavan. It's advisable to use cycle-rickshaws or walk to the temple to avoid parking hassles.
Cycle-rickshaws and auto-rickshaws are the most common and convenient ways to navigate Vrindavan's streets and reach the Radha Vallabh Temple.
While not strictly necessary for this temple, local guides can offer deeper insights into the temple's history and significance if you're interested.
The temple has stairs and uneven pathways, which might pose challenges for individuals with mobility issues. It's best to inquire directly about specific accessibility options.
🎫 🎫 Tickets & Entry
No, entry to the Radha Vallabh Temple is free for all devotees and visitors. Donations are welcome to support the temple's upkeep.
The temple typically opens early in the morning and closes in the late evening. Specific timings for darshan and aarti can vary, so it's best to check locally or online.
Visiting during weekdays, especially early in the morning or late in the evening, offers a more serene experience with fewer crowds.
There isn't a formal 'special darshan' ticket system. The focus is on experiencing the temple's spiritual atmosphere during its regular hours.
Photography is strictly prohibited inside the main temple complex, especially near the deity. Please respect this rule.
🎫 🧭 Onsite Experience
The temple is renowned for its unique deity, Radha Vallabh, symbolizing the divine union of Radha and Krishna. The continuous kirtans and devotional atmosphere are also highlights.
Dress modestly, covering your shoulders and knees. Avoid revealing clothing. Traditional Indian attire is appreciated but not mandatory.
The temple holds various aarti ceremonies throughout the day. Witnessing these can be a deeply spiritual experience. Check the daily schedule upon arrival.
Devotees often offer prasad (blessed food) to the deities. You can inquire with temple authorities about the procedure for offering prasad.
The 24-hour kirtan is a continuous chanting of the Hare Krishna mantra, creating an unending stream of devotional energy and spiritual bliss for all present.
🍽️ 🍽️ Food & Dining
Generally, food stalls or restaurants are not located within the main temple premises. However, you can find numerous eateries and street food vendors in the vicinity.
You'll find a variety of Indian vegetarian dishes, including local Vrindavan specialties, sweets, and snacks. Look for places serving fresh, sattvic food.
Explore the lanes around the temple for local dhabas and restaurants. Many offer simple yet delicious vegetarian meals.
Sometimes, prasad is distributed after aarti or special occasions. It's best to inquire with temple volunteers or priests about its availability.
Don't miss trying local sweets like peda, lassi, and various chaats. Many restaurants also serve thalis for a complete meal experience.
